Understanding the fundamentals of structural engineering is essential when considering any construction project. This understanding will not only help you make educated decisions, but also ensure that your project will be secure and lasting for many years.
Structural engineering is a branch of civil engineering that deals with the design and study of buildings to ensure they can bear the pressures they will encounter. It’s about making sure that buildings will stay upright under their own weight, as well as external pressures such as wind, earthquakes, and snow.
The job of a structural engineer is to ensure that the design of a building is sturdy enough to withstand all forecasted loads. This involves choosing the right materials, planning the layout of the building, and studying the strengths and weaknesses of the design.
One key aspect of structural engineering is the selection of construction materials. The standard of the materials used can substantially affect the robustness of the building. Various materials have different strengths and weaknesses, and the choice of material will depend on the kind of building, the climate, and budget.
Finally, technology plays a significant role in modern construction. It helps in all things from creating the structure to examining its strength, and even in building the structure itself. Modern software can simulate how a building will behave to various loads, helping to guarantee the security of the structure.
In conclusion, understanding the principles of structural engineering is essential for any construction project. It involves everything from the plan of the building to the choice of materials, and the employment of technology. This knowledge will not only guide you in making educated decisions, but also ensure that your project will be stable and last for many years.
